    Holding the contents in place

    Where a product needs to be held still, a fitted insert cut to its profile does more for damage rates than a heavier outer board. It usually costs less too, because you can drop a grade on the outer.

    What moves the price

    Four things drive a quote more than anything else: the quantity, the print route, the board grade and the number of finishing passes. Dimensions matter too, but usually through how efficiently the shape nests on the press sheet.

      Will a heavier board reduce my damage rate?

      Only if boxes are arriving crushed. If they arrive intact with damaged contents, the product is moving inside and a heavier outer changes nothing. A fitted insert solves that case, usually at lower cost.

      Do you supply inserts with the outer?

      Yes, and for 500 bubble mailers we prefer to specify both together. A cavity that holds the contents still often lets us drop a grade on the outer, so the pair can cost less than an over-specified box alone.

      How do I reduce dimensional weight?

      Measure the product rather than the box currently in use. Most operations we quote are running at least one size too large with void fill compensating, and dropping a band saves on every parcel 500 bubble mailers carry.

      Should the outside be printed?

      That is a brand decision, not a cost or protection one. For direct-to-consumer parcels where the customer opens it, print can be worth it. For business deliveries it usually is not.
